I Bond Investors: Here’s Your Buying Guide For 2018
Summary Wait at least until the March inflation number is announced on April 11. You then enter a three-week ‘limbo period’ when you can decide to buy before or after the May 1 rate reset. Don’t bother buying I Bonds … Continue reading

Recapping 2017: The Year In Treasury Inflation-Protected Securities
Summary The year was marked by rising short-term real yields, as longer-term yields held stable or declined. If economic growth continues, longer-term real yields should begin rising. Watch for the 10-year real yield to climb toward 1.0%. The year’s TIPS … Continue reading

5-Year TIPS Reopening Auctions With A Real Yield Of 0.370%
Summary The after-inflation yield of 0.370% was the highest in two years for any 4- to 5-year TIPS auction. Reaction to the auction looks positive, with the TIP ETF rising minutes after the close, indicating higher demand. The inflation breakeven … Continue reading
